Five Things I Will Miss About St. Louis:

5.  Forest Park. There are so many cool things to see and do there, and many of them are free, like the Zoo, the Muny, portions of the museums, and all the hiking/biking trails!  Additionally, there's

4.  Free concerts and performances.  They're everywhere in St. Louis in the summer.  Seriously.  At the zoo, at the Botanical Gardens, at the small municipal parks, in Forest Park (annual Shakespeare in the Park festival), and of course, at the Muny.

3.  The small-town feel and pride with the population/sprawl of a big city.  Even with a metropolitan area of roughly 3 million people (last I heard), everyone still loves the same home-town team (Go Cards!), "Meet Me in St. Louis" is a perennial favorite at the Muny (and everyone in the audience can sing along with the title song with gusto), nearly every driver has picked up the same set of driving-style quirks (St. Louis rolling stop, anyone?), our city's rich historical heritage is celebrated at nearly every possible opportunity, and every St. Louisan knows that when you meet another St. Louisan (especially outside of STL), you will ALWAYS ask (or be asked) where you went to high school!

2.  The Cardinals.  'Nuff said.

1.  The food.  Ted Drewes, Italian from The Hill, St. Louis-style ribs, St. Louis Bread Company, toasted ravioli, Imo's, and provel cheese.  Mmm, now I'm hungry...
